Removal Procedure
- Open the hood.
- Battery Negative Cable - Disconnect - Battery Negative Cable Disconnection and Connection
- Air Inlet Grille Panel (2) - Remove - Air Inlet Grille Panel Replacement
- Windshield Garnish Molding (1) - Remove - Windshield Garnish Molding Replacement
- Windshield Multifunction Sensor Mount Bracket Cover (1) - Remove - Windshield Multifunction Sensor Mount Bracket Cover Replacement (without UHX)
, or Windshield Multifunction Sensor Mount Bracket Cover Replacement (with UHX)
- {If equipped} Front View Camera (1) - Remove - Front View Camera Replacement
- Inside Air Moisture and Windshield Temperature Sensor (1) - Remove - Inside Air Moisture and Windshield Temperature Sensor Replacement
- Inside Rearview Mirror - (2) Remove - Inside Rearview Mirror Replacement
- Cover to protect the following parts from broken glass:
- Upper Dash Pad
- The defroster outlets and A/C outlets
- The seats and carpeting
- Remove the lower windshield supports from the cowl panel, if equipped.
- Using the appropriate tool, carefully cut around the lace (1), start in the center working from side to side of the window to access the urethane adhesive bead, if equipped.
- This will allow the urethane adhesive to be separated from the windshield.NOTE:
Keep the cutting edge of the tool against the window.
- Leave a base of urethane on the pinchweld flange.
- The only suitable lubrication is clear water.
- BO-24402-A Glass Sealant Remover (Cold Knife).
- Use commercially available glass cutting tool.
- With the aid of an assistant, remove the windshield (1) and locating pin (2) from the vehicle.
